Output 6663f789799595c814a450bcd4db81acdde807f41c64c51292aeb23301e75961:1

value
2750600
script pubkey
OP_0 OP_PUSHBYTES_20 e053fb747aa3f89c6212bae5116204e3ea226c19
address
bc1qupflkar650ufccsjhtj3zcsyu04zymqecsq7xu
transaction
6663f789799595c814a450bcd4db81acdde807f41c64c51292aeb23301e75961
spent
true